[Solved] No Internet connection when I enable eth1

Featured Replies

as stated whenever I enable eth1(10G) i lose internet to unraid

unable to ping google servers

tried changing dns servers(on unraid) to my router/main pc/google/cloudflair

nothing seems to work but

when i disable my eth1(10G) and run just on eth0(1G) everything works as normal

and when i disable i mean change IPv4 address assignment from "static" to "None"

Thanks in advance

majesty-diagnostics-20210707-1404.zip

  • Community Expert

What setting are you using for eht1? It can't be in the same subnet and you should leave the gateway blank.
